Description

Hotel opened in 1974, renovated in 2009. In this hotel 336 rooms, 16 floors.

Policies and conditions

  • Child policies: Children of all ages are welcome at this property. Additional fees may be charged for children using existing beds. Add the number of children to get a more accurate price.
  • Cribs and Extra Beds: Extra bed and crib policies may vary according to room type. Please refer to the room type details for more information.
  • Breakfast: Option: Set menu Opening hours: [Mon - Fri] 07:00-11:00 Open
    [Sat - Sun] 08:00-09:00 Open Contact the property to see if extra breakfast is available. If so, you can pay for it at the property.
  • Pets: Pets are allowed on request Types of pets allowed: dogs Fee: US$25.00 per pet per night
  • Service animals: Service animals are allowed on request
  • Age Requirements: The main guest checking in must be at least 21 years old
  • Paying at the hotel: Visa, AmericanExpress, MasterCard
  • Check in time: 16:00. Check out time: 11:00.

19.01.2026 Aurelia
The hotel is just a really old hotel with a lip stick renovations and you can see it clearly. The light in our bathroom would not stay on a flickered, the carpet smelt musty, the air conditioner was so loud, tile was largely cracked and chipped in the shower. Small details like the phone in the room being very dirty and old. It seems housekeeping is doing what they can, but some things are just very old and need to be updated. The refreshments and cookies from front desk staff is a nice treat, but the decor and overall age of the hotel room did not make for a comfortable stay. Location is good.

10.01.2026 Jayda
Overall our stay was good - staff was friendly and helpful, location was perfect. For some reason we never had our room cleaned in three nights. Overnight I put the tag on the door so we wouldn’t be woken up so early for room cleaning, but then we were never in our room during the day and nobody ever came to do it. And then, unfortunately, the elevator situation was terrible. I have never waited 25 minutes to get down an elevator with my luggage before. And I know there were others that waited longer than us. I get the hotel was busy and everyone was trying to check out at the same time, but it was a very frustrating experience.
